The extended Delaunay tessellation (EDT) is presented in this paper as
the unique partition of a node set into polyhedral regions defined by
nodes lying on the nearby Voronoï spheres. Until recently, all the FEM
mesh generators were limited to the generation of tetrahedral or
hexahedral elements (or triangular and quadrangular in 2D problems). The
reason for this limitation was the lack of any acceptable shape
function to be used in other kind of geometrical elements. Nowadays,
there are several acceptable shape functions for a very large class of
polyhedra. These new shape functions, together with the EDT, gives an
optimal combination and a powerful tool to solve a large variety of
physical problems by numerical methods. The domain partition into
polyhedra presented here does not introduce any new node nor change any
node position. This makes this process suitable for Lagrangian problems
and meshless methods in which only the connectivity information is used
and there is no need for any expensive smoothing process.
